'The Field' Takes Residence in the Twilight Zone

Stone Village has picked up spec thriller The Field, by tyro scribes Sean Wathen and Josh Dobkin. The story (which sounds like an episode right out of "The Twilight Zone") is set in an endless field, where a group of strangers wake up with seemingly random items and must find a way out. Stone Village is producing and financing. Benderspink exec produces. Stone Village's recent credits include the Javier Bardem starrer "Love in the Time of Cholera" and the horror pic "Turistas." It is developing a remake of Akira Kurosawa pic "Ikiru" at DreamWorks and a bigscreen adaptation of Spanish novel "The Anatomist."
